Josiah Judson Hazen (December 11, 1871 – October 20, 1948) was an American college football player and coach. He served as a player-coach at Williams College in 1899 and 1901.[1] Hazen died on October 20, 1948, at Middlesex Hospital in Middletown, Connecticut.[2]
